About this item
Highlights
- Innovative auto features: 1-Touch 'A Bit More', 'Lift and Look', Bagel, and Frozen functions derived directly from your feedback makes for flawless toasting.
- Extra long 4-slice capacity: Larger artisanal bread, thick bagels and dense pastries demand longer slots, so we answered the call.
- Variable browning control: Toast to your ideal brownness level while the LED indicates your browning progress.
- Easy cleaning: No need to ever lift when cleaning. Just pull out the front crumb tray and tip it into the dustbin.

Dimensions (Overall): 7.6 Inches (H) x 8.1 Inches (W) x 16.1 Inches (D)
Weight: 5.9 Pounds
Appliance Capabilities: Toasters
Number of Slices: 4
Wattage Output: 1800 Watts
Material: Stainless Steel
Care & Cleaning: Spot or Wipe Clean

Summary of reviews
The toaster offers a sleek design and features like a bit more button and a lift and look option, making it convenient for various types of bread. However, many guests have reported issues with uneven toasting, unreliable heating elements, and flimsy controls. While some appreciate its performance for bagels and thick slices, others express disappointment in its durability and consistency, leading to mixed experiences overall.

Dumb programming on bit more and multiple toast cycles
3 out of 5 stars
Paul burns toast - 9 months ago
originally posted on breville.com
Programming dumbness. If I want to add time to a toast in progress cycle I'll move the slide bar over. If I want to add a tiny amount of brown to a finished cycle I'll hit a bit more. However if you depress the lever and then hit a bit more you won't be adding a small amount of time for a tiny bit more browning. You'll be burning toast if you forget to touch the button BEFORE depressing the lever. Sounds silly but when you're making breakfast for four it's east to get the sequence out of order. REMOVE the dumb adding extra time while toasting function from this button. If I want more time WHILE something is toasting I can slide the lever over. Re program that button to only allow the tiny amount of time for the cycle. The slider takes care now of adding time during toasting---that NO ONE USES. Also if I toast a second round of times right after the first, the toaster is so hot that although I have the same setting the second toast batch will be burned. Programming should automatically reduce cycle time on second batch of that cycle is started within two minutes of first batch.
